Here is the companion the previous handout. This one details actions during combat. From coup de grace to equiping a shield, all designed to prevent the need to flip through the PHB again and again.

Included are two actions not found in the 4e PHB: Disarm and trip. They were designed along the lines of the bull rush action, and complement it well. Where bull rush is a simple strength vs. fortitude, disarm is a dexterity vs. reflex, and trip is in the middle, allowing either attack type. Do note that like bull rush, neither have the Weapon keyword, and therefore you do not add any modifiers from your weapon to the attack.
